Here are a few ""signs"" that may indicate your baby is ready for Solid Foods: o Loss of tongue-thrust reflex - This allows baby to drink and swallow liquids with ease; with the tongue-thrust reflex still present, baby may simply drink in liquid purees or push the food back out. According to experts, in the first four months the tongue thrust reflex protects the infant against choking. When any unusual substance is placed on the tongue, it automatically protrudes outward rather than back. Between four and six months this reflex gradually diminishes, and that glob of cereal actually may have a chance of making it from the tongue to the tummy! o Having reached the end of 6 months from ‘Due Date’ not ‘Birth Date’, o Ability to let you know she is full from a ""meal"" with signs such as turning away from the bottle or breast. This is important so that baby is able to self-regulate the amount of food being eaten. This helps stop baby from accidentally overeating as parents may continue to feed baby thinking that she is still hungry. o Ability to sit up and hold head up unassisted o Interest in your food o Doubling of birth weight
